About College of Dairy Science and Technology

Overview

  • Official Name: College of Dairy Science and Technology, Mannuthy, Thrissur
  • Common Name: College of Dairy Science and Technology Thrissur
  • Type: State Government College affiliated to Kerala Veterinary and Animal Sciences University (KVASU)
  • Year Established: 1993
  • Campus Location: Mannuthy, Thrissur district, Kerala

Courses & Programs

  • Faculty: Dairy Science and Technology (Specialized faculty under KVASU Agricultural/Veterinary umbrella)
  • Popular Courses:
    • B.Tech Dairy Science & Technology – Duration: 4 years – Mode: Regular – Intake: Approx. 30 students per annum
    • M.Tech Dairy Chemistry and Technology – Duration: 2 years – Mode: Regular – Intake: Not specified
    • Ph.D. in Dairy Science and allied specializations – Duration: 3–5 years – Mode: Regular/Research

Admissions

  • Admission Modes: Through Kerala State Engineering Entrance (KEAM) for B.Tech Dairy Science & Technology; University-level counselling for PG and Ph.D.
  • Accepted Entrance Exams: KEAM (Kerala Engineering Architecture Medical Entrance), GATE for PG, and university internal selection tests for Ph.D.
  • Important Dates: KEAM application – March-April; counselling – June–July; PG admission – July–August; consult CEE Kerala Official Portal and KVASU Admissions.

Eligibility Criteria

  • B.Tech Dairy Science & Technology: 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, and Biology; minimum 50% marks in PCM/PCB combination; KEAM rank required.
  • M.Tech Dairy Chemistry and Technology: Bachelor’s degree in Dairy Science, Food Science, or relevant branches with minimum 55% marks.
  • Ph.D. Programs: Master's degree in Dairy Science, Veterinary Science, Food Technology, or related fields; minimum 55% marks.
  • Documents Required: 10th & 12th mark sheets, entrance exam scorecard, community certificate (if applicable), transfer certificate, passport size photos, ID proof, migration certificate (for PG/Ph.D.).

Placements & Career Outcomes

  • Placement Highlights: Placement rate ~70% for eligible candidates; average CTC ₹3.5 LPA; highest CTC up to ₹6 LPA reported internally (no official published report)
  • Top Recruiters: Amul, Parag Milk Foods, Mother Dairy, Kerala Co-operative Milk Marketing Federation (KCMMF), Dairy Development Departments

How to Reach

  • Nearest Airport: Cochin International Airport (COK), approx. 60 km from Mannuthy, Thrissur
  • Nearest Railway Station: Thrissur Railway Station (~12 km from campus)
  • City Connectivity: Frequent buses and taxis available from Thrissur city to Mannuthy locality
  • Local Transit: Auto-rickshaws, KSRTC buses service routes covering the college
